> The {{read_json_arrow()}} function lacks a {{schema}} argument, and it is not possible to specify a schema through {{JsonParseOptions}}. PyArrow allows the user to pass a schema to {{read_json()}} through {{ParseOptions}} to bypass automatic type inference. Implement this in the R package.
